Alasdair Gold claims Tottenham could look to sell ‘phenomenal’ player for £20m
Tottenham Hotspur defender Joe Rodon is enjoying a great season on loan at Leeds United.
So much so, in fact, that Spurs could potentially demand £20million to sell him, according to Alasdair Gold.
Tottenham signed Rodon back in 2020 in a deal . However, he has struggled to make a mark at Spurs.
This has led to two loan stints away from the Tottenham Hotspur Stadium, the first one tricky and the latter superb.
Spurs sent Rodon out on loan to French side Rennes last season, but they didn’t take up the option to buy at the end of the campaign.
The Wales international joined Leeds this season, and he’s finally showing the form that made him such a star at Swansea City.

Gold, speaking on the , believes that Tottenham could demand more than what they paid for if he helps Leeds back into the Premier League.
“I think Joe Rodon’s going to go for a fair whack of money,” he said. “I think this is exactly what Spurs want from these kind of loan deals.
“Especially with having no option on the deal, Leeds, Rodon could be up there. You know, he could be like £15m upwards.
“Maybe even if he is incredible and gets them up, you could be looking at £20m. Spurs could end up making a profit on him.”
